#680e11 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#680e11 is composed of 40.8% red, 5.5%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.5% magenta, 83.7%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 358 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 23.1%. #680e11 color hex could be obtained by blending #d01c22 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#680e11

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fdeeee is the lightest one.

Tones of #680e11

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3737 is the less saturated color, while #760004 is the most saturated one.
